Output 83d8658d279b2018c2f377b5f7f1d3ae8876820596d9b08fdf0e3cfd4f4bbcb3:2

value
1977393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51e6c4c2cedee6584dc7f3c7a376fe9ed3184db5 OP_EQUAL
address
MFNDR3xBx31XdBQr4yuuGhN54V4E5rbeQV
transaction
83d8658d279b2018c2f377b5f7f1d3ae8876820596d9b08fdf0e3cfd4f4bbcb3
spent
true